Yes, installing the most recent available version (patch 7) of any 7.02 / 7.03 
ITSM app on a system with the other apps already installed and patched beyond 7 
will clobber the existing apps.  This was very well documented in the Patch 008 
and Patch  009 Release Notes, and is why we refused to install Asset on our 
existing Patch 009 system with IM, PM, CM, SLM, and RKM when we finally 
acquired Asset as part of the Suite licensing.  We will not install Asset until 
we migrate to 7.6.x.

We were already sensitized to this by what happened when we installed Patch 007 
to the apps we do have, after most of our customization had been done on Patch 
006; it clobbered them too.  I was able to migrate everything and retain the 
customizations because we patched dev, migrated from prod to dev, then patched 
prod, and migrated back from dev.  Note that most customizations for ITSM 
7.02/.03 are simply not going to work in 7.6.00.x, and I suspect that to be 
even worse in 7.6.03 (but I haven't gotten past the *%$#^& Atrium Core upgrade 
to find out), due to fundamental changes in the HPD and CHG ticketing table 
structures.

We are faced with a little dilemma.

We have ITSM 7.3 (Helpdesk, Problem, Asset)  all with patch 8.0

We have installed Change Management 7.3 and planning to bring it to the same 
patch level as  the rest the ITSM modules.

We can install CM patch 7.0 or Patch 9.0!!

CM patch 7.0 will first put the rest of  ITSM modules  at patch 7.0 and then we 
can apply patch 9.0 to all modules after that.

Patch 9.0 will be needed since we are thinking about upgrading to 7.5 later 
this year. So patch 9.0 I guess is a must for 7.5.

After applying patch 7.0 (today) and to my surprise the whole application looks 
as if it were out of the box. Hardly a single field, form or workflow  shows 
any of the customization we did. Luckily we took a copy of the database and 
back up all the binaries etc...

So what to do next?  Leave change unpatched will not make sense.

Try to patch it to a patch less than 7.0 and a patch that would not overwrites 
the customization could be an option but as it states  in the release notes of 
ARS 7.5, ITSM should be at patch 9.0 at least.

Keep patch 7.0, apply patch 9.0 and then import all the customization?

Any thought on this?
